Re:Dactylospora stygia ?
Dear Patrice
I saw a number of collections which all have shorter spores. But all are identified as cf. stygia. One has spores like yours, but are smooth. How distinct is this striation, do you have a photo? Could you please correct your spore width (should be around 4-5 µm).
One specimen from Puerto Rico resembles yours....
